1976: The Birth of Apple - Pivotal Moments

With founders who are now household names and technology that continues to grow and push the market, it’s no wonder that in 2018, Apple made history. They became the world’s first publicly traded company to achieve a market capitalisation of $1 trillion.

1981: Adam Osborne Invents the Laptop - Pivotal Moments

It wasn’t until March 1980 that Osborne approached engineer Lee Felsenstein with his idea. Like Steve Jobs, Felsenstein was a member of the HomeBrew Computer Club and an ex-Intel engineer. Osborne proposed that a company create affordable, portable computers with installed software. And he wanted Felsenstein to develop the hardware.
